Space Mission Three
5-11 November 2016
The third Space Mission UK programme is specially designed around the objectives of the entrepreneurs taking part. This week long trip, taking place from 5-11 November 2016, will take a group of Space entrepreneurs to San Francisco and Los Angeles.
NB. As with all missions, this programme is subject to change – this page will have the latest version and you can follow the mission @innovateuk on Twitter.
